titleOfInvention | BONE-SEEKING COMPLEXES OF TECHNETIUM-99m |
abstract | A composition for use in the preparation of a bone visualization agent comprises a mixture of a bisphosphonic acid of formula (I), wherein R1 and R3 may be the same or different groups selected from H, -SO3H and a lower aliphatic group optionally containing one or more hetero atoms and containing at least one -SO3H group; R2 is a group selected from H, -OH, -NH2, -NHMe, -NMe2 and lower alkyl optionally substituted by one or more polar groups; R4 is a group selected from H, -OH, -NH2, -NHMe, -NMe2, -SO3H and lower alkyl optionally substituted by one or more polar groups; n is 0 or 1; provided that when n is 0, R1 is not H and when n is 1, R1 and R3 cannot both be H. Also disclosed is a non-toxic salt of said composition, as well as a reducing agent for pertechnetate ions. Technetium-99m, in the form of an aqueous solution of pertechnetate ions, is added to the composition to form a complex of Tc-99m and bisphosphonate. This complex is useful as a bone tissue visualization agent and is rapidly absorbed by these tissues, giving high definition images. |
